Endicott College Internship Stipend
Starting in 2011, a limited stipend program is offered to support travel costs for students completing semester-long internships. The intent of the stipend is to encourage students to take advantage of exceptional internship opportunities that might have parking or other transportation costs associated with them.
Criteria for receiving the award - The stipend will be available to students who apply for the stipend based on financial need.
Eligibility - The stipend will only be considered for an internship that is more than 20 miles from the campus if the student is a resident student, or more than 20 miles from their residence if a commuter.
Award amount - Stipends may be approved up to $200 for the semester.
Award payment schedule - A credit will be issued to the student’s tuition account. If the student has a credit balance, a refund check will be issued in the student’s name. If a student has an outstanding tuition balance, the credit will be applied towards the outstanding balance.

Class of ’52 Internship Stipend
Endicott College Class of ’52 Internship Fund
Established in 2007 by Estelle Jones, Class of 1952, and her husband Charles, the Class of ’52 Internship Fund supports students enrolled in Semester-Internship, providing a stipend to help defray commuting costs for unpaid internship positions. Through Estelle’s leadership, the Class of 1952 has generously established the funding to offer two awards each year in the amount of $250 each. The awards are made in the junior year for internships to take place in the senior year.
Eligible Candidates must meet all of the following criteria:
- Must be in their junior year at the time of application, completing the Semester-Internship in September of their senior year (students completing Semester-Internship in the Spring semester of their junior year are not eligible)
- Must have an approved Internship Proposal at the time of application
- Must demonstrate financial need for the award (including detail of expected expenses such as commuter rail train pass, the subway pass, gas, and car insurance)
- The internship must be unpaid.
